So, how do you give your eyeglasses a sparkling shine? The process is surprisingly simple, requiring just a few basic materials and a bit of elbow grease. Here are the 5 simple steps to give your eyeglasses a sparkling shine:
- Microfiber cloth and eyeglass cleaning solution.
- A soft-bristled toothbrush or a small, soft-bristled brush.
- White vinegar and water (for a natural lens cleaner).
- Polishing cloth (microfiber or soft, dry cloth).
Step 1: Clean Your Eyeglasses
The first step in giving your eyeglasses a sparkling shine is to clean them thoroughly. Use a microfiber cloth and eyeglass cleaning solution to wipe down your frames, lenses, and any other metal parts. Be sure to clean all sides of your glasses, including the temples and nose pads.
Step 2: Remove Tarnish and Debris
Next, use a soft-bristled toothbrush or a small, soft-bristled brush to gently remove any tarnish, debris, or stubborn stains from your eyeglasses. Be careful not to scratch the lenses or frames.
Step 3: Clean the Lenses
For a deeper clean, mix equal parts white vinegar and water in a small bowl. Dip a microfiber cloth into the solution, wring it out, and gently wipe down your lenses. This will help remove any stubborn stains or grime.
Step 4: Dry Your Eyeglasses
Use a soft, dry cloth to dry your eyeglasses, paying extra attention to the lenses and frames. This will help prevent water spots and streaks.
Step 5: Polishing Your Eyeglasses
Finally, use a polishing cloth to give your eyeglasses a sparkling shine. This will help remove any remaining streaks or imperfections, leaving your eyeglasses looking like new.
